Default FBody Alternator VS Truck Alternator Dimensions

Does anybody have a side by side comparision of the FBody vs Truck Alternator? I am looking for some good numbers on dimensions or a clear side-by-side picture. The reason I am looking for this is due to very close clearences with my LQ4, truck acccesseries, truck intake, 2nd Gen Trans Am swap.

There are two different physical sizes of alternator used on trucks. Im not sure on the ratings but there's a big one and a smaller one. The big one wont fit an f body accessory drive, but the smaller one will. The small one is identical to the f body one with the exception of where the small rear bracket bolts on isn't on the truck alternator. You don't really need it though. I've had a.truck alternator on my ls1 for thousands of miles with no problems.
